Patient's Query

Hello doctor,

I missed my periods by ten days, and since the last four days, there has been a transparent watery discharge from the vagina with a foul smell. Please help.

Delayed periods are associated with different issues like hormonal abnormalities, pregnancy, or stress.

Were you sexually active during the last month or last couple of weeks? If the answer is no, then pregnancy is not the cause. If you were, then I would suggest you get a pregnancy test done at home with the help of the available kits in the market. If it comes negative, then repeat it after a week or two. If it still comes negative, then consult a gynecologist in person. Are you on any medications currently? Sometimes this can happen due to some medications.

So wait for another week or two, and even after that, if you do not get your periods, seek medical help from a gynecologist. She will examine you and suggest appropriate medicines to induce the periods if required.
